Across the country, there is an urgent call for transformational
high school reform. The Servant Leader and High School Change
addresses the plea for secondary school reinvention, inspiring the
reader to get more involved in local school improvement efforts.
Wallace captures_in story form_what students, teachers,
administrators, and parents have been saying for a long time: there
is a simpler, more effective way to run a people-centered school.
Following a struggling high school principal who has lost his way,
Wallace demonstrates what can happen in one school year when a
gifted mentor gets the attention of the principal who is his
student and teaches him the real meaning of servant leadership,
thus transforming not only the principal, but the entire school and
community.
